Dead Coin Battery

If the Bentley Flying Spur remote control does not lock the doors or unlocking the doors it could be because the battery inside the coin has failed. The battery can be replaced, but it's essential to use a new battery that has the same voltage, size and specification. Incorrect batteries can damage the key fob.

Verify the tension of the metal clips that secure the key fob the correct position. If the clip is loose or damaged, it may cause contact issues and cause a loss of power transfer to the remote control. Worn Buttons

The buttons made of rubber on the Bentley key fob may get worn out over time. They're not able to press against the receiver module, causing it not to respond to key commands. This is a simple fix since new buttons can be reprogramed by the dealer.

Poor Battery Contact

The battery in the key fob of your Bentley is fixed by metal retaining clips. The clips may lose tension or corrode, which prevents the battery from making electrical contact with the chip. A poor connection can cause the remote control to stop working.

If the key fob has been submerged in soapy water, salt water, or pool water, the chip inside could be damaged and must be replaced. Before you attempt to clean the chip it is recommended you remove the key fob from the water and allow it to dry completely before replacing it.

If your bentley key repair key fob isn't functioning, it may require repair or replaced. There are a variety of reasons that could cause it to stop working, such as a dead coin battery or a damaged remote control chip. A damaged battery could cause the keyfob to not connect with your vehicle.

The first step in diagnosing an issue with a key is to determine whether the battery in the button cell is depleted. If it is, replace it with another battery with the same voltage and size. After that you can test the fob by pressing its buttons. If the fob isn't working, the issue is probably due to other problems, such as water damage.
